An individual only purchases two goods X and Y . The person has an income of $100. The price of X is $2 per

unit and the price of Y is $4 per unit. The utility function of this individual is U = 3X +5Y . This means the person

has a constant marginal utility of 3 and 5 for goods X and Y , respectively. What bundle of goods X and Y should

the person buy to maximize utility. Why? (Answer: 50 units of X and none of Y giving a utility of U = 150)

Please show all steps, and sketch the indifference curve and the budget line representing the optimal bundle of goods.

0 0
Add a comment Improve this question Transcribed image text
Answer #1

MRS = MUx/MUy = 3/5 = .6

Px/Py = 2/4 = .5

As MRS > Px/Py

IC is always steeper than budget line

MUx/Px > MUy/Py

Extra dollar spent on gives higher additional Utility, as compared to the, utility when extra dollar spending on Y

so Only X is consumed at eqm

X* = M/Px = 100/2 = 50

Y* = 0
